#f33da4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f33da4 is composed of 95.3% red, 23.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 32.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 326 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 59.6%. #f33da4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#e70049.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f33da4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f33da4 has RGB values of R:243, G:61,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.33,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15941028.

Shades and Tints of #f33da4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090105 is the darkest color, while #fef6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f33da4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9499 is the less saturated color, while #fb35a5 is the most saturated one.
